You were in your quiet little house looking out of the window, heavy rain bouncing onto your living room window. You only saw a few cars driving by, their headlights blazing through the storm. You smiled as you touched the glass with your forehead, taking in the coolness. You actually enjoyed the rain. It always gave you a chill that you liked. You exhaled onto the glass causing it to fog up a bit. You took your finger and drew a skull on the window. Suddenly, your house phone rang. You stood up and went for the phone.

"Hello?" You heard cheering and yelling through the earpiece.

"WASSUP (NAME)!!! IT'S THE AMAZING HERO!!!!!" You cringed at the volume that Alfred was yelling.

"Tone it down, Alfred. Why are you calling me?" You heard Alfred chuckle nervously.

"Well, I'm at the bar with a friend and I kinda....need help?" You groaned. You knew exactly who Alfred was talking about. There was only one man who would cause enough trouble at a bar to make the "hero" ask for help.

~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

"Alright, where is he?!" Everyone stared at your outburst. You arrived to the bar, a bit piss that your time of peace was ruined. You then turned your head to the counters and face-palmed. There was Arthur, standing tall and proud while waving his butt in the air, not caring about the weird looks he was receiving. You groaned and headed straight for the counter. There, you saw Alfred and growled menacingly.

"Alright, what happen?" Alfred shrugged.

"We just came to the bar and he said it was on him so I thought we could have a contest, ya know?"

"Yet, you already know what happens when he gets drunk." Alfred gave you a nervous smile, in fear of you're growing resentment towards the American. .

"Oi, (Name) forget the numbnut. You better take my damn brother somewhere else. He's ruining business." You turned to see Allistor, Arthur's big brother, washing a few beer cups wearily . You rolled your eyes.

"Yeah, yeah, I know! Alfred, help me with-" Alfred was already out the door when you turned to him. You groaned and  kicked the nearest stool.

"That son of a dick. When I get my hand on him..." You continued grumbling things that slightly frighten the Scottish bartender. You felt arms wrapped around you.

"(NAME)! You came! I missed you~! Let's go on an adventure to Candy Land!" You sighed and pat Arthur on the head.

"Yes, yes. Let's do that, but first I gotta get you home." You looked at Allistor.

"Would you mind if you could help me with him?" Allistor scoffed.

"Hell no, that brother of mine has already caused enough trouble for me. Better if he just left." You shook your head and proceed to half carrying Arthur out the bar.

"Things I do for you." You felt Arthur snuggled onto you.

"You smell so nice." You felt like slamming your head on a wall, a bit embarrassed by the sudden statement. Arthur was always flirtatious when he was drunk. Not that it helped you in anyway possible. You were about to open your car door when you felt Arthur getting off of you.

"Hey, don't move or-" Too late. Arthur, still drunk, fell facedown on the wet and muddy ground. You began slamming your head on your car, earning weird looks by midnight walkers.. This was going to be a long night.

You manage to get Arthur into the car. In the driver seat, you were driving in a steady speed. It was raining so there was a big chance of a crash if you went any faster. Then there was the drunk Arthur in the seat next to you who could do the most unexpected. Right now, he was singing Barbie Girl except he forgot some of the lyrics so he started jumble some up. It was a big headache but you manage to arrive to his house. 

You got out of the car and proceed to getting Arthur out. Luckily, you didn't drop him. However, when you reached to the door, Arthur suddenly vomited on the ground. It narrowly missed you, but the smell was evident. You looked up at the sky, asking who the hell up there on why was she even doing this. Today wasn't your day.

You reached for Arthur's back pocket to get his house keys. You then unlocked and opened the door, proceeding to carry Arthur inside. You sighed and dropped Arthur on the couch. You stared at him in pity. His clothes were messy and soiled with mud, vomit and beer. He didn't smell great either. His hair lost it's usual shine. His eyes were half open and you can barely see the bright emeralds that you were so used to seeing. You looked at the time. It was late and you should be heading home right now, yet you didn't want to leave Arthur, leaving him so pathetic. You gave out an exasperate sigh and smiled sadly.

'Alright, what to do first?' You looked around the house for a mop and bucket. You decided to clean the mess that Arthur made outside. It took awhile to get the stench out but the rain helped a bit. You then got back inside the house. Arthur seemed to have rolled himself off the couch.

"Alright, time to clean yourself up, Arthur." You heard him mumble something. You grabbed one of Arthur's arms and pulled him up. He had difficulty standing up but you managed to get his balance correct. You led him to the bathroom.

"Alright, stay here and I'll get you some clothes." You headed for his room. It was a neat orderly space with a drawer, a desk, one medium bed and a closet. You went through his drawers, looking for some clothes for Arthur. You passed some of his undergarments.

"So, he's a boxer guy? Huh." You manage to get a clean t-shirt, some black pajama pants, and boxers. You went back to the bathroom and set the clothes down.

"Alright, you take a bath and I'll put away some stuff." You turned on the water and left. You were heading for the kitchen when you heard a crash.

"Shit." You raced toward the bathroom and you stifled a laugh. Arthur was on the ground in an unusual mess. He seemed to have trouble getting off of his clothes. You helped him up. Arthur began to cling on you like a baby.

"(Name)," he whined, "can you help me..." You sighed.

"Man, you seriously owe me." You got him to stand by himself as you began helping him out of his clothes. You figured out that Arthur was beginning to be sober but he still wasn't coordinated to do things by himself. You unbutton his shirt and noticed his slim smooth body....

"GAH!" You jumped.

'No, (Name) No staring!' You face-palmed. You continued unbuttoning the shirt, your face in a red scowl. Arthur was topless. Next was his pants. You rubbed the bridge of your nose with your fingers, a bit irritated of your position.

"I think you should take it from here" Arthur was stripping in pants but he kept wobbling around, so close to falling down, again. You growled and helped balance Arthur, trying to not look down. When he got that off, you immediately left the room, not wanting to see anything else. You collapsed onto the couch. Things you did for him. If you weren't his best friend, you would have ditched him. You sighed. And you thought you were going to enjoy a quiet night at home. You blew a couple of hair strands from your face. You heard a bang and a yelp.

'Not again!' You went back to the bathroom. Arthur was laying sprawled on the floor of the shower. Great, he can't even take a simple bath without help. Trying not to look past his upper torso, you tried to find a way to clean him up without seeing what should not be seen.

"What to cover up..." You headed back to Arthur's room. You began looking through his stuff, trying to get some plan. You then noticed a pair of swimming trunks.

'Perfect' You could have Arthur wearing these and help him wash up. You then found a plastic stool and headed back to the bathroom. You gave Arthur the swimming trunks and ordered him to put them on. You then put the stool in the bathtub and had Arthur sit on it. Using the shower hose, you sprayed water all over his head, getting it nice and wet. You then got a bottle of shampoo and started pouring it over his head. Slowly, you began to massage and lather his hair. It felt unusual to be in our position but it was also quite calming. You were slowly rubbing his scalp, getting the suds over his head. You finally got the hose again and began getting all the shampoo off his hair. You were careful not to get it in his eyes by tilting his head back. You saw his face and smiled. Arthur was looking very serine, almost like a sleeping child.

 You got the shampoo off and it was time to clean the rest of him. You poured soap all over him and got out a bath brush. You began scrubbing his body gently but firmly, making sure that when you were done, he wouldn't be smelly. It was difficult since Arthur was a bit limp so you had to lift his limbs to clean him correctly. After you were done with that, you got the hose again and started washing the suds off of him. You also used a wash cloth to make him a bit more clean. You heard him sigh in content. It made you smile. 

Finally you were done. You helped Arthur out of the tub. You got a big clean towel and started drying him up. Arthur just stood there, still a bit drunk and dazed. You were slowly drying his hair when Arthur let out a small sneezed. You chuckled. He looked exactly like a little child. You then ordered him to take his swimming trunks off and put on his boxers and other clothes. You continued helping him putting on his shirt. At last, Arthur was cleaned up and you were ready to take him to bed.

"Alright Arthur, let's get you to bed." Arthur whined like a child.

"I don't wanna, (Name) I'm not tired!" You patted Arthur's head like you were with a child.

"Now, now. You had a big day. It's time for sleepy time, okay?" Arthur grumbled and nodded.

You led Arthur to his room and laid him down on the bed. You put his sheets over him and smiled.

"Good night Arthur." You turned to go but a hand grabbed yours. You turned around.

"Something wrong?"

"(Name) don't leave me, please." You raised an eyebrow.

"What do you mean by that?" Arthur pulled you closer to the bed. You heard sniffling.

"J-Just don't leave me alone. I don't want to be alone. It hurts." You noticed tears coming down slowly from his face. Your eyes widen. It was the first time that you ever seen Arthur cried. It wasn't natural. You were used to seeing him glaring or blushing when he was upset, but seeing him cry.......it gave you a feeling of emptiness.

"I-I'm not going to leave you Arthur. You're my friend." You heard Arthur scoffed slightly. He let go of your hand and shifted in his bed.

"Everyone leaves me behind, even friends. No one likes me. My older brother hates me and doesn't want to do anything involve with me. He regrets that I'm his brother. I helped took care of Alfred but look at us now. He doesn't even want to be with me, wants to be free and such. People who I take care off end up leaving me, telling me that they have had enough of me. I can't even have a steady relationship with my old girlfriend. Chelles ditch me for that frog face. Says he's better looking and all."

You frowned. You remembered Arthur's ex-girlfriend, Chelles. She was a nice girl but she was too carefree, not the best choice for Arthur's girlfriend. It wasn't a surprise when she broke up with him.

"See! Everyone just wants to get away from me. I'm the dirt of this world. No one ever wants to stay with me. Even you will leave me one day."

"Arthur, what makes you say that?" Arthur put slowly brought his right arm on top of his eyes, hiding it from your view. However, it did not stop the tears from falling from his face. You were tempted to wipe them off.

"When I sleep and wake up, you won't be here. You'll be at your house." You sighed.

"I'm not going to leave. I'll be right here, I promise." Arthur was silent but in his mind, he didn't take your words. He knew you were going to leave when he slept. There was no way out of it. Slowly, sleep began to consume him. You saw that Arthur was sleeping and exhaled. You turned for the door out the room. You took one last look at Arthur and left.

~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

Arthur slowly began to wake up. He sat up with a huge headache.

"God, I'm never going to drink again...." Arthur looked at the time. It was 4 in the morning. He put some effort on remembering what happened last night. He remembered you helping him home and giving him a bath. Arthur went pink at the memory. He then remembered what happened before he slept. He remembered asking you not to leave his side. Obviously you weren't here and you have left for home. Arthur grumbled in pain from the hangover and in depression, as he was a bit hopeful that you would stay. Arthur sighed and got the covers off him. He got off of the bed and stepped on something soft and fell face first hard on to the ground.

"Arrghh!!!" "OWW!!!!" Arthur lifted his face up in pain. It did not make his hangover better. Arthur heard a voice behind him.

"Man, you gotta what where you're going. My chest isn't something to step on." Arthur turned around to see you on the ground in a sleeping bag. His eyes widen.

"(NAME)?! What the hell are you doing on the ground?!" You groaned.

"I was trying to imitate a dried up blow fish. What did you think I was doing?!"

"I-I thought you went home already!" You rolled your eyes.

"Well, you told me to stay here with you so I just got one of your sleeping bags in your garage and came back in your room to sleep." Arthur stuttered.

"Y-You did?"

"Of course, I promised, didn't I?"

"I-I guess you did, I just didn't think you meant it...." You grinned.

"You're my friend, why the hell would I lie to you." Arthur smiled in content. It almost got him to forget his headache. Almost...

Arthur was still wincing from the pain. You looked at him in worry.

"What me to help you with the hangover?" Arthur groaned and could barely nod. You helped Arthur stand up and got him into the kitchen. You gave him a glass of water and began cooking over the oven. You manage to get him some biscuits, egg, and sausages. You put some on two different plates and gave on of the plates to Arthur. He thanked you and began eating. You ate your plate. It was silent for the whole time. By the time you finished, Arthur was already done, taking the time to watch you eat. You took both plates and began cleaning up, a bit self-conscious of yourself. Arthur just sat in his seat, not knowing what to do. He wasn't used to the feeling that was bubbling up in his chest. It was warm, full, making him feel full of content.

Suddenly, he let out a yawn. You turned around, an eyebrow up in question. Arhur looked back sheepishly. He was still tired, only getting 5 hours of sleep. His eyes were getting droopy.It was better if he went to sleep again. He stood up and stretched, reveiling his lean abdomen to you, who was pretty happy with the view.

"I'm going to continue sleeping. Still abit out of it. what about you?" You looked at the time, andrubbed your eyes. It did sound good to sleep a bit more. You looked at Arthur and nodded. Both of you walked towards the bedroom, getting tired with each second. Arthur crawled on to his bed, getting under the blankets. You stood in his room, a bit awkward of the situation. You shooked your head mentally, getting a hold of yourself.

You were about to get down to the ground when suddenly, Arthur grabbed your hand and pulled you towards him. You fell right into the bed, surprised to do anything. Arthur wrapped his arms around your waist and sighed in content. You laid there, a bit nervous, but nevertheless happy.

"Um..Arthur? What are you doing?"

"Sleeping."

"You know I can sleep on the ground."

"No, I want you here. I can't just leave you on the ground, love. What kind of man am I if I did?"

"Are you serious?" You heard Arthur chuckled. You turned your head to face him, seeing his sleepy green eyes. He smiled lazily and kissed you on the forehead. Your cheeks went hot, but you turned your head, accepting your little predicament. You felt Arthur snuggle onto your head, kissing your hair. You smiled and snuggled right back into his body, feeling warm and happy. He hugged you tighter. As you drifted off to sleep, you whispered a few last words.

"Hey, Arthur, I don't think I'll ever leave you." Arthur's heart skipped a beat.The last thing you heard were 2 words by your ear.

"Thank You"
